/*
 * Max prefetch window for the Wanderhall audio-guide app.
 * Galleries in the Ostwick wing have terrible signal, so we
 * prefetch the next few exhibit tracks. Bumping this past 5
 * murders older devices' storage — ask the Relic team before
 * touching it. Baked into each release; the provenance token
 * for this constant's build is recorded below.
 */

session token of kageg-tahop = htk14_af3c1ccccb7dcf

TICKET-2290: Parcel-tracking webhook dropping deliveries

The Swiftbound webhook receiver fails to persist tracking events whenever the courier burst exceeds 400 req/s; the DB pool times out and events are lost rather than retried. Fix adds a bounded retry queue and raises the pool ceiling. Reviewer: please verify the receiver picks up the store via the connection string below.

replica DSN, kagug-tafof: clickhouse://norir_svc:elHq8Ay@db-9735.halixdyn.internal:5432/rusax

### Step 4 — Locker Access Service

Deploy the Tumblegate access service to the Marrow Street cluster. It issues short-lived unlock tokens when a resident scans at a laundry locker; tokens expire in 90 seconds and are single-use. Audit logs stream to the Hollis vault unmodified. Token issuance requires the service to hold the signing key shown below.

release key, hadug-kawef: bky13_mPGeFZeR1GZ1G